B SCARED

from the keyboard of that sexy and talented Jack Kinley:

What: B Scared—Art Show and Carnival Extraordinaire!

When: Friday, October 31, 8:00 p.m. to 1:00 a.m.

Where: The B Complex
1272 Murphy Ave, SW
Atlanta, GA 30310



The B Complex—an artist cooperative community in Atlanta's West End—is undergoing a costume change of sorts as it transforms from one of the city's most rustic re-purposed industrial spaces into an old fashioned carnival of sorts this Halloween. Organizers at the co-op have compiled works from over 20 artists which explore traditional day of the dead imagery, various interpretations of modern-day Halloween rituals, as well as explorations of the psychological and emotional aspects of fear.

But don't come to the B Complex expecting "just another art show." And please don't show up in your blazer and turtleneck like your stereotypical art critic—unless of course, that's your costume for the evening. The B Complex throws a wild party and what, if any, is a better excuse to party than Halloween? The 8,000 square foot exhibit space will be bustling with the sounds of DJ Dr. Tim, performances by aerialists Dances in Air, and a very special treat from Atlanta's very own burlesque troupe—Dames Aflame. Resident artists have transformed the two-acre compound with black-lights, fire sculptures, carnival games and spooky surprises around every corner. And for those of you who wait until the last minute to plan your Halloween costumes, custom masquerade masks will be available on site!

A $20 cover ($15 for those in costume) gets you access to all of the evening's entertainment—including an open bar, as long as it lasts!
